The trueCABLE Cat5e Riser (CMR) is a 1000ft bulk Ethernet cable featuring 24AWG solid bare copper conductors, supporting up to 2.5 Gbps speeds and 350 MHz bandwidth. It supports advanced PoE++ (4PPoE) delivering up to 100W, ideal for powering devices over Ethernet. Designed for indoor riser applications, it comes in a tangle-free, easy-pull box and meets ETL and ANSI/TIA standards, ensuring safety and performance for professional installations.

Update: Work even if cable is longer then 60ft
I built 3 cable for my IP camera using this wire. The ones that are 30ft or less work fine. The one that is 60 ft doesn't work. I can't connect to the camera because the link quality is so low. When I ping it, I only get 25 to 50% reply. No, it's not the camera because I tried it with a 2 different cameras and they behaved the same. So don't buy this cable if you plan long network cable run. Update 5/6/19 Updated to 5 stars. I found out why the 60 foot cable doesn't work. I used only half of the twisted green wire for network and half for DC power by mistake. That was why there was too much noise on the network and hence lost half of the pings. I started over with twisted orange and green pair for ethernet and the twisted brown and blue for power and my IP camera worked fine.

Good cable - real copper conductors (not that CCA stuff).
I use a box or two a year working with students (making patch cables etc). This brand of cable has worked well for me punching down to old 110 and 66 blocks as well as direct RJ45 connectors. The insulation on inner wires is well colored and easy to see (I've had some other types have semi translucent insulation that makes green and blue hard to distinguish as well as stripped vs unstripped - tough on new learners).
